Today we’d like to introduce you to Castle Rock Chamber.
Hi Castle Rock, so excited to have you with us today. What can you tell us about your story?
Founded in 1955, we started with a simple and very important objective to support and promote local businesses which continues to drive everything we do today. The Chamber has a long history of championing initiatives that make Castle Rock and Douglas County great. Our mission is to cultivate a thriving business community through engagement, collaboration, and advocacy. We are proudly celebrating our 70th anniversary with more than 500 members.

The Castle Rock Chamber offers robust programs and activities designed to connect, educate, and empower local businesses and community leaders. Each year, the Chamber hosts Signature Events such as the Annual Gala, Golf Classic, Sip & Savor, Douglas County Fair Parade, Artfest, and Starlighting. A host of networking opportunities and talent pipeline initiatives are offered through Business Unwind, Leads Generation Groups, grand celebrations, and more. Professional development is supported by programs including Leadership Douglas County, NextGen Young Professionals, eXcelerate, Women of Influence and Tours for Teachers. Additionally, the Chamber operates the Castle Rock Visitor Center with resources for residents, tourists, and those considering relocation to the region. Shop the Rock features local attractions, businesses, shops, restaurants, and more opportunities to explore the charm of the Town.
What sets the Castle Rock Chamber apart is its Five-Star Accreditation by the U.S Chamber of Commerce – a prestigious designation held by only two Chambers in Colorado recognized for achievement in organizational excellence. This accolade reflects our high standards in leadership, strategic planning, and member services. Our integration of the Castle Rock Chamber Foundation adds a philanthropic dimension while oversight of the Visitor Center enhances tourism – creating a multifaceted value proposition for members and the broader community.
